Also got myself some Lightscribe DVDs to burn my data onto. For those of you that don't know, Lightscribe is a technology that uses your DVD burner as a labeler for the top of your recording medium as well. Generally, I'm quite happy with it because I'm sure it lasts longer than marker does and you don't have to worry (I think) about it fading. And it looks nice too :D
